Topic: Getting date ranges out of Rec6

Hi
We have been trying to send data for upload to NBN but it now requires start date, end date and date type. Can anyone advise how to get this information out of Recorder 6?

Re: Getting date ranges out of Rec6

If you use the NBN Exchange add-in from http://jncc.defra.gov.uk/page-4597 the date is output as start date, end date and date type. I checked this in v6.23 of the add-in.

Re: Getting date ranges out of Rec6

Hi Sally
We had the NBN Exchange add-in installed and working but since we have run updates on our Rec6, the link must be broken because it does not appear as one of our export options. We have tried to re-install the add-in but it is saying it is already there. What should we do?

Re: Getting date ranges out of Rec6

If I remember correctly, the solution to this is to uninstall the add-in in Recorder 6 then remove the add-in files from C:\Program Files (x86)\Recorder 6\Addins, or your equivalent, then reinstall it.
